Find the missing value for x^?/x^7=x^12

Answers

Answered by GPT-4o mini
To solve the equation \( \frac{x^?}{x^7} = x^{12} \), we can use the properties of exponents.

First, we can rewrite the left-hand side of the equation:

\[
\frac{x^?}{x^7} = x^{? - 7}
\]

Now, we can set the exponents equal to each other since both sides of the equation have the base \( x \):

\[
? - 7 = 12
\]

To find the value of \( ? \), we can add 7 to both sides:

\[
? = 12 + 7
\]

\[
? = 19
\]

Thus, the missing value for \( x^? \) is:

\[
\boxed{19}
\]
